Why Big Tech is threatened by a global push for data sovereignty
Developing nations are challenging Big Tech’s decades-long hold on global data by demanding that their citizens’ information be stored locally. The move is driven by the realization that countries have been giving away their most valuable resource for tech giants to build a trillion-dollar market capitalization.In April, Nigeria asked Google, Microsoft, and Amazon to set concrete deadlines for opening data centers in the country. Nigeria has been making this demand for about four years, but the companies have so far failed to fulfill their promises. Now, Nigeria has set up a working group with the companies to ensure that data is stored within its shores.
“We told them no more waivers — that we need a road map for when they are coming to Nigeria,” Kashifu Inuwa Abdullahi, director-general of Nigeria’s technology regulator, the National Information Technology Development Agency, told Rest of World.
Other developing countries, including India, South Africa, and Vietnam, have also implemented similar rules demanding that companies store data locally. India’s central bank requires payment companies to host financial data within the country, while Vietnam mandates that foreign telecommunications, e-commerce, and online payments providers establish local offices and keep user data within its shores for at least 24 months.

Zelensky urges ‘Marshall Plan-style‘ support for Ukraine at Recovery Conference in Rome. This conference marks the fourth major international event focused on mobilizing political and private-sector support for Ukraine’s reconstruction.
Russia’s summer offensive becomes its costliest campaign during Ukraine invasion, Economist reports. The Economist estimates roughly 31,000 Russian soldiers were killed in the offensive so far, in comparison to some 190,000-350,000 deaths and up to 1.3 million overall Russian casualties of the entire full-scale war.
With partner finances, Ukraine ‘will shoot down everything‘ amid escalating Russian drone attacks, Zelensky says. President Volodymyr Zelensky confirmed Russia’s intention to drastically escalate its drone attacks, potentially launching up to 1,000 drones per day, but noted that Ukraine already has effective countermeasures.
Ukraine detains Chinese spies tasked with stealing Neptune missile technology, SBU says. According to the SBU, the two individuals, a 24-year-old former student of a Kyiv technical university and his father, were gathering classified documentation with the intent to illegally transfer it to Chinese intelligence.

Trump to send weapons to Ukraine for first time via presidential power, sources tell Reuters. Until now, the Trump administration’s military aid to Ukraine had only consisted of weapons authorized by former President Joe Biden. The Presidential Drawdown Authority allows the president to directly transfer weapons from U.S. military stocks in response to an emergency.

L'origine dei fusi orari è dovuta ai treni
Sir Sandford Fleming, un ingegnere scozzese residente in Canada, nel 1879 propose un sistema molto pratico: dividere il pianeta in ventiquattro fusi orari di quindici gradi di longitudine ciascuno, con un'ora standard per ogni fascia e un «tempo 0» basato sul meridiano di Greenwich, che sarebbe stato il riferimento comune per tutto il mondo.
Grazie a questo, gli orologi e gli orari furono finalmente uniformati.
